Avatar do último membro que postou no tópico
+2
Cream
gabeahero
6 participantes
Fórum dos Fóruns :: Ajuda e atendimento ao utilizador :: Questões sobre códigos :: Questões resolvidas sobre HTML e BBCode
Página 1 de 1
Avatar do último membro que postou no tópico
Qual é minha questão:
Olá olhem o print abaixo:
Tipo tem o avatar da pessoa que postou... Gostaria bem daquela forma ali xD se puderem me ajudar.
Atenciosamente.
GabeAHero.
Endereço do meu fórum:
http://rpglegendary.forumeiros.com
Versão do fórum:
PUNBB
Olá olhem o print abaixo:
Tipo tem o avatar da pessoa que postou... Gostaria bem daquela forma ali xD se puderem me ajudar.
Atenciosamente.
GabeAHero.
Endereço do meu fórum:
http://rpglegendary.forumeiros.com
Versão do fórum:
PUNBB
Última edição por gabeahero em 08.02.13 15:17, editado 2 vez(es)
Re: Avatar do último membro que postou no tópico
Olá,
Seguindo tutorial só substitua o código JavaScript por este
Depois adiciona este código em sua Folha de estilo CSS
Até
Seguindo tutorial só substitua o código JavaScript por este
- Código:
jQuery(document).ready(function(){
if(!window.localStorage) return;
// Avatar par défaut
var default_avatar= 'http://i.imgur.com/4v2MR.png';
// Temps de cache, ici 24 h * 60 m * 60 s * 1000 ms donc un jour
var caching_time= 24*60*60*1000;
// Temps de cache d'une erreur, ici 60 s * 1000 ms donc une minute
var caching_error= 60*1000;
var set_avatar= function(id) {
$('.mini_ava.member'+id).html('<img src="'+get_avatar(id)+'" />');
};
var get_avatar= function(id) {
if(localStorage.getItem('t_ava'+id) < +new Date - caching_time || (localStorage.getItem('d_ava'+id)==default_avatar && localStorage.getItem('t_ava'+id) < +new Date - caching_error))
{
localStorage.setItem('d_ava'+id, default_avatar);
$.get('/u'+id, function (d){
localStorage.setItem('t_ava'+id,+new Date);
localStorage.setItem('d_ava'+id, $('#profile-advanced-right .module:first div img:first,.forumline td.row1.gensmall:first > img, .frm-set.profile-view.left dd img,dl.left-box.details:first dd img, .row1 b .gen:first img, .real_avatar img',d).first().attr('src')||default_avatar);
set_avatar(id);
});
}
return localStorage.getItem('d_ava'+id);
};
var to_replace= {};
$('dd.lastpost strong a.gensmall, .ipbtable tr td:last-child span strong a.gensmall, .table td.tcr strong a.gensmall, .forumline .row3.over strong a.gensmall').each(function(){
to_replace[$(this).attr('href').substr(2)]= 1;
$(this).closest('td,dd').prepend('<div class="mini_ava member'+$(this).attr('href').substr(2)+'"></div>');
});
for(i in to_replace)
{
set_avatar(i);
};
});
Depois adiciona este código em sua Folha de estilo CSS
- Código:
.mini_ava {
float: left;
}
.mini_ava img {
padding:1px;
border:1px solid #515151;
background:#393939;
-webkit-box-shadow:0px 2px 2px rgba(0,0,0,0.1);
-moz-box-shadow:0px 2px 2px rgba(0,0,0,0.1);
box-shadow:0px 2px 2px rgba(0,0,0,0.1)
}
.mini_ava img:hover {
border-color:#5f5f5f;
-webkit-box-shadow:0px 2px 2px rgba(0,0,0,0.2);
-moz-box-shadow:0px 2px 2px rgba(0,0,0,0.2);
box-shadow:0px 2px 2px rgba(0,0,0,0.2)
}
.mini_ava img /* Edite para a altura e largura */ {
height:30px; /* Altura */
width:30px; /* Largura */
}
Até
Re: Avatar do último membro que postou no tópico
Olá!
Utilize esse código Javascript com o Investimento em todas as páginas:
Aceda á "Folha de estilos CSS"
Painel de Controle Visualização Imagens e Cores Cores Folha de estilos CSS
Código:
Melhores cumprimentos,
Today
Utilize esse código Javascript com o Investimento em todas as páginas:
- Código:
var AVATAR_INDEX='true';var AVATAR_SUBFORO='false';var AVATAR_AUTHOR='true';eval(function(p,a,c,k,e,r){e=function(c){return c.toString(a)};if(!''.replace(/^/,String)){while(c--)r[e(c)]=k[c]||e(c);k=[function(e){return r[e]}];e=function(){return'\\w+'};c=1};while(c--)if(k[c])p=p.replace(new RegExp('\\b'+e(c)+'\\b','g'),k[c]);return p}('2 0=3;$(4(){0=5});$.6(\'7://8-9.a.b/c/d/1/e-f-g.1\');',17,17,'READY_AVATAR|js|var|false|function|true|getScript|http|scripts|giobanii|googlecode|com|svn|trunk|view|avatar|system'.split('|'),0,{}))
Aceda á "Folha de estilos CSS"
Painel de Controle Visualização Imagens e Cores Cores Folha de estilos CSS
Código:
Valide..avatar-index{float:left}.avatar-index img{border:1px solid #DDD;height:40px;margin:0 5px;padding:1px;width:40px}.avatar-index img:hover{border:1px dashed #CCC}.avatar-author-post{float:right}.avatar-author-post img{border:1px solid #DDD;height:40px;margin:0 5px;padding:1px;width:40px}.avatar-author-post img:hover{border:1px dashed #CCC}
Melhores cumprimentos,
Today
Consolado- Hiper Membro
- Membro desde : 09/05/2011
Mensagens : 4243
Pontos : 6128
Re: Avatar do último membro que postou no tópico
Bom dia,
Provavelmente o tutorial apresenta algum problema. Pedirei para o responsável por ele avaliar e fazer as devidas correções. Enquanto isso, tente com um tutorial do FdF francês: http://forum.forumactif.com/t338068-
Até mais.
Veja o link do tutorial oficial novamente, acabei de atualizá-lo.
Provavelmente o tutorial apresenta algum problema. Pedirei para o responsável por ele avaliar e fazer as devidas correções. Enquanto isso, tente com um tutorial do FdF francês: http://forum.forumactif.com/t338068-
Até mais.
Veja o link do tutorial oficial novamente, acabei de atualizá-lo.
Re: Avatar do último membro que postou no tópico
Olá!
Utilize esse código Javascript no índice ou em todas as páginas:
Até mais.
Utilize esse código Javascript no índice ou em todas as páginas:
- Código:
;jQuery(document).ready(function(){jQuery('td.tcr').prepend('<div class="avat-miembro"><div>'); jQuery('td.tcr .avat-miembro').each(function () { var profileUserURL = jQuery(this).parent().children('span').children('strong').children('a').attr('href'); jQuery(this).html('<a href="' + profileUserURL + '" class="avat-miembro-enlace"><img src="Endereço-da-imagem" alt="No Avatar" /></a>'); jQuery(this).children('a').load(profileUserURL + ' .module:eq(0) img:eq(0)') });});
Até mais.
Tópicos semelhantes
» Avatar do último membro que postou no tópico
» Erro no avatar do ultimo membro que postou no topico
» Avatar do último membro que postou no tópico
» Problemas com o código do avatar do ultimo membro que postou no tópico
» Avatar do último membro que postou no tópico bug
» Erro no avatar do ultimo membro que postou no topico
» Avatar do último membro que postou no tópico
» Problemas com o código do avatar do ultimo membro que postou no tópico
» Avatar do último membro que postou no tópico bug
Fórum dos Fóruns :: Ajuda e atendimento ao utilizador :: Questões sobre códigos :: Questões resolvidas sobre HTML e BBCode
Página 1 de 1
Permissões neste sub-fórum
Não podes responder a tópicos